(8.5-2x)(11-2x)(x) what is the approximate value of x that would allow you to construct an

Mathematics
1 answer:
Wittaler [7]1 year ago
4 0

The largest volume possible from one piece of paper for open-top box is 64.296 cubic unit.

<h3>What is meant by the term maxima?</h3>
  • The maxima point on the curve will be the highest point within the given range, and the minima point will be the lowest point just on curve.
  • Extrema is the product of maxima and minima.

For the given question dimensions of open-top box;

The volume is given by the equation;

V = (8.5-2x)(11-2x)(x)

Simplifying the equation;

V = x(4x² - 39x + 93.5)

Differentiate the equation with respect to x using the product rule.

dV/dx = x(8x -39) + (4x² - 39x + 93.5)

dV/dx = 8x² - 39x + 4x² - 39x + 93.5

dV/dx = 12x² - 72x + 93.5

Put the Derivative equals zero to get the critical point.

12x² - 72x + 93.5 = 0.

Solve using quadratic formula to get the values.

x = 4.1  and x = 1.9

Put each value of x in the volume to get the maximum volume;

V(4.1) =  4.1(4(4.1)² - 39(4.1) + 93.5)

V(4.1) = 3.44 cubic unit.

V(1.9) = 1.9(4(1.9)² - 39(1.9) + 93.5)

V(1.9) = 64.296 cubic unit. (largest volume)

Thus, the largest/maximum volume possible from one piece of paper for open-top box is 64.296 cubic unit.

The researcher has limited resources. He sends 9 emails from a Latino name, and 14 emails from a non-Latino name. For the Latino
deff fn [24]

Answer: 38.41 minutes

Step-by-step explanation:

The standard error for the difference in means is given by :-

SE.=\sqrt{\dfrac{\sigma_1^2}{n_1}+\dfrac{\sigma^2_2}{n_2}}

where , \sigma_1 = Standard deviation for sample 1.

n_1= Size of sample 1.

\sigma_2 = Standard deviation for sample 2.

n_2= Size of sample 2.

Let the sample of Latino name is first and non -Latino is second.

As per given , we have

\sigma_1=82

n_1=9

\sigma_2=101

n_2=14

The standard error for the difference in means will be :

SE.=\sqrt{\dfrac{(82)^2}{9}+\dfrac{(101)^2}{14}}

SE.=\sqrt{\dfrac{6724}{9}+\dfrac{10201}{14}}

SE.=\sqrt{747.111111111+728.642857143}

SE.=\sqrt{1475.75396825}=38.4155433158\approx38.41

Hence, the standard error for the difference in means =38.41 minutes
